756 * PCI Error Recovery System (PCI-ERS). If a PCI device driver provides
757 * a set of callbacks in struct pci_error_handlers, that device driver
758 * will be notified of PCI bus errors, and will be driven to recovery
759 * when an error occurs.
762 typedef unsigned int __bitwise pci_ers_result_t;
764 enum pci_ers_result {
765 /* No result/none/not supported in device driver */
766 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NONE =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 1,
768 /* Device driver can recover without slot reset */
769 PCI_ERS_RESULT_CAN_RECOVER =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 2,
771 /* Device driver wants slot to be reset */
772 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NEED_RESET =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 3,
774 /* Device has completely failed, is unrecoverable */
775 PCI_ERS_RESULT_DISCONNECT =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 4,
777 /* Device driver is fully recovered and operational */
778 PCI_ERS_RESULT_RECOVERED =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 5,
780 /* No AER capabilities registered for the driver */
781 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NO_AER_DRIVER =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 6,
784 /* PCI bus error event callbacks */
785 struct pci_error_handlers {
786 /* PCI bus error detected on this device */
787 pci_ers_result_t (*error_detected)(struct pci_dev *dev,
788 enum pci_channel_state error);
790 /* MMIO has been re-enabled, but not DMA */
791 pci_ers_result_t (*mmio_enabled)(struct pci_dev *dev);
793 /* PCI slot has been reset */
794 pci_ers_result_t (*slot_reset)(struct pci_dev *dev);
796 /* PCI function reset prepare or completed */
797 void (*reset_prepare)(struct pci_dev *dev);
798 void (*reset_done)(struct pci_dev *dev);
800 /* Device driver may resume normal operations */
801 void (*resume)(struct pci_dev *dev);
808 * struct pci_driver - PCI driver structure
809 * @node: List of driver structures.
810 * @name: Driver name.
811 * @id_table: Pointer to table of device IDs the driver is
812 * interested in. Most drivers should export this
813 * table using M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(pci,...).
814 * @probe: This probing function gets called (during execution
815 * of pci_register_driver() for already existing
816 * devices or later if a new device gets inserted) for
817 * all PCI devices which match the ID table and are not
818 * "owned" by the other drivers yet. This function gets
819 * passed a "struct pci_dev \*" for each device whose
820 * entry in the ID table matches the device. The probe
821 * function returns zero when the driver chooses to
822 * take "ownership" of the device or an error code
823 * (negative number) otherwise.
824 * The probe function always gets called from process
825 * context, so it can sleep.
826 * @remove: The remove() function gets called whenever a device
827 * being handled by this driver is removed (either during
828 * deregistration of the driver or when it's manually
829 * pulled out of a hot-pluggable slot).
830 * The remove function always gets called from process
831 * context, so it can sleep.
832 * @suspend: Put device into low power state.
833 * @resume: Wake device from low power state.
834 * (Please see Documentation/power/pci.rst for descriptions
835 * of PCI Power Management and the related functions.)
836 * @shutdown: Hook into reboot_notifier_list (kernel/sys.c).
837 * Intended to stop any idling DMA operations.
838 * Useful for enabling wake-on-lan (NIC) or changing
839 * the power state of a device before reboot.
840 * e.g. drivers/net/e100.c.
841 * @sriov_configure: Optional driver callback to allow configuration of
842 * number of VFs to enable via sysfs "sriov_numvfs" file.
843 * @err_handler: See Documentation/PCI/pci-error-recovery.rst
844 * @groups: Sysfs attribute groups.
845 * @driver: Driver model structure.
846 * @dynids: List of dynamically added device IDs.

1525 * pci_irqd_intx_xlate() - Translate PCI INTx value to an IRQ domain hwirq
1526 * @d: the INTx IRQ domain
1527 * @node: the DT node for the device whose interrupt we're translating
1528 * @intspec: the interrupt specifier data from the DT
1529 * @intsize: the number of entries in @intspec
1530 * @out_hwirq: pointer at which to write the hwirq number
1531 * @out_type: pointer at which to write the interrupt type
1533 * Translate a PCI INTx interrupt number from device tree in the range 1-4, as
1534 * stored in the standard PCI_INTERRUPT_PIN register, to a value in the range
1535 * 0-3 suitable for use in a 4 entry IRQ domain. That is, subtract one from the
1536 * INTx value to obtain the hwirq number.
1538 * Returns 0 on success, or -EINVAL if the interrupt specifier is out of range.
